Woosmap Search Assets Integration

service Description

The Woosmap Search Assets API endpoint is a valuable tool for developers who need to manage and query assets such as stores, ATMs, and any other points of interest (POIs) for their web or mobile applications. This endpoint performs various tasks including searching for assets, filtering them based on different criteria, and retrieving detailed information about each asset. By utilizing this functionality, several problems related to location-based searches and asset management can be addressed efficiently.

Capabilities of the Woosmap Search Assets API Endpoint

With the Search Assets API endpoint, developers can:

  • Perform proximity searches: Users can find assets that are within a specific radius from a point, such as their current location or any given address. This is useful for apps that require a "near me" feature.
  • Apply filters: Assets can be filtered based on various properties such as type, tags, or custom metadata. This helps users find assets that meet specific requirements or preferences.
  • Sort results: The API supports sorting the search results by distance or by a specific property, giving users a way to easily identify the most relevant assets.
  • Retrieve detailed information: When an asset is selected, the API can provide detailed information including address, contact information, opening hours, and any custom data associated with it.

Problems Solved by the Woosmap Search Assets API Endpoint

The Woosmap Search Assets API endpoint can solve a range of problems related to asset discovery and information retrieval:

  • Geographical asset discovery: Users can find assets closest to them or in a specific area, enhancing the user experience by showing relevant results based on location.
  • Custom user experiences: By utilizing filtering and sorting options, developers can tailor user experiences to individual preferences and needs, creating more personalized interactions with the app.
  • Up-to-date asset information: The API allows for real-time retrieval of asset details, ensuring that users have access to the most current information available, which is crucial for assets with frequently changing information like opening times or availability.
  • Integration with other services: The API can be integrated with other services like mapping or routing APIs to provide additional context and functionality for the discovered assets, such as showing the asset on a map or providing directions to it.
